Five college football programs face increased pressure for 2026 season
Summary

Five college football programs are expected to perform this upcoming season, with significant pressure on each to improve their standings. Florida State, Tennessee, and Clemson look to bounce back after recent struggles, while Nebraska's performance is critical after years of underachievement. Sacramento State aims to elevate its profile after joining the MAC, increasing the stakes as it invests heavily in this new chapter. With the 2026 season approaching, these teams must deliver results to meet fan expectations and secure their positions in college football history.

By the Numbers
  • Florida State suffered through six losing seasons in eight years.
  • Tennessee looks to show improvement after an 8-5 record last season.
  • Clemson experienced its worst season under Dabo Swinney, finishing 7-6.
  • Nebraska needs to improve following years of underachievement.
  • Sacramento State invests $23 million over five years in MAC membership.
